The Decalogue - Krzysztof Kieslowski (1989)


          The Ten Commandments have never been something I think about often. I usually assume I'm doing okay with those, probably not killing or stealing or having other gods... hopefully. This series of films puts the Commandments into situations I understand and could see myself being part of. There's something so real about these films, a reality I haven't experienced with any other film. Rather than use metaphors and symbols to reveal truth, Kieslowski uses truth to reveal truth. What's more true than physical, inescapable consequences? In my reading of the film, I felt that there was no abstract in the world Kieslowski created, only truth and consequences, and at the same time we sympathize with the people and their mistakes, because we know it could be and probably has been one of us making those same choices.
